Purbba Radhanagar
Khanakul-I block · Hooghly
district, West Bengal · PIN 712401
· village code 325879
Population 2011
5,582
Census of India
Population 2020
3,549
Mission Antyodaya survey
Change
-36.4%
-2,033 people · -4.9% a year
Households
1,330
+5.1% vs 1,266 in 2011
Census 2011
Total population
5,582
Male / female
2,873 / 2,709
Sex ratio females per 1,000 males
943
Children aged 0–6
622
Literacy rate
66.6%
Scheduled Caste / Scheduled Tribe
2,208 / 4
Working population
1,992
Of workers, in agriculture cultivators and farm labour
59.5%
Households
1,266

Gram panchayat finances, 2024–25
XV Finance Commission grant for
Balipur panchayat, Khanakul-I zila parishad.
These are the panchayat's own accounts, not this village's: where a panchayat
holds several villages, the money covers all of them, and where a village
spans several panchayats only this one's return appears.
Opening balance
₹68.32 lakh
Received from state (auto-transfer)
₹69.23 lakh
Received directly
₹1.50 lakh
Spent
₹89.35 lakh
Unspent at year end
₹49.70 lakh
Untied (basic grant)
opened ₹7.00 lakh · received ₹28.45 lakh · spent ₹20.08 lakh · left ₹16.87 lakh
Tied (earmarked)
opened ₹61.32 lakh · received ₹40.78 lakh · spent ₹69.27 lakh · left ₹32.83 lakh
Source: eGramSwaraj, as reported by the panchayat. Untied and tied
together make up the totals above.
